Definition and Meaning of Basic Application Software

Basic application software refers to programs designed to assist users in carrying out specific tasks, focusing primarily on personal, business, or academic activities. Common examples include word processors, spreadsheets, and presentation software. These tools are fundamental for performing tasks like document creation, data analysis, and information presentation, making them an integral part of daily operations in various settings.

Types of Basic Application Software

  • Word Processors: Tools like Microsoft Word and Google Docs, used for composing, editing, and formatting text documents.
  • Spreadsheets: Applications such as Microsoft Excel or Google Sheets, essential for data organization, analysis, and calculation.
  • Database Management Systems: Software like Microsoft Access, used to store, retrieve, and manage data efficiently.
  • Presentation Graphics: Programs like Microsoft PowerPoint that help create visual presentations to effectively communicate ideas.

Key Elements of Basic Application Software

Understanding the core elements of basic application software ensures effective use and maximizes output. Key elements typically include:

  • User Interface: Refers to how the software appears to the user, including menus, buttons, and layout.
  • Functional Tools: Features such as text editors, formula bars, or design templates that facilitate specific tasks.
  • Compatibility: Ability to work seamlessly with other software and across different operating systems.
  • Security Features: Protects user data and privacy, often involving password protection and data encryption.

Important Terms Related to Basic Application Software

Understanding critical terminology associated with basic application software can enhance comprehension and usage:

  • User Interface (UI): The visual part of the software that interacts with users.
  • Functionality: The range of operations that the software is capable of performing.
  • Usability: Ease with which users can learn and work with the software.
  • Interoperability: Ability to exchange information between different systems and software applications.

Application software is a type of computer program that performs a specific personal, educational, and business function. Each application is designed to assist end-users in accomplishing a variety of tasks, which may be related to productivity, creativity, or communication.
